We encourage links to the state and county table of contents. __________________________________________________________ The Date of this Indenture 20 June 1792 The Geography for this Indenture Turbutt Township is near Milton, Northumberland County, PA Names mentioned in this Indenture are: James Duncan David Ireland John MacPherson Robert Magaw William McClayt Alexander McDonald Robert Moodie William Plunket Patrick Redman Christian Rona Robert Robb John Simpson Northumberland County DEED BOOK F pages 79 & 80 Robt Robb & Jn Macpherson Deed to David Ireland for 217 1/2 acres of land This indenture made the twentieth day of June in the year of our Lord one thousand seven hundred & ninety two. Between Robert Robb of Muncy Township & John Macpherson of Buffalo Township in the County of Northumberland & State of Pennsylvania Esq's of the first part. And David Ireland of Turbutt Township in the County & State Afs. Yoeman of the Other part. Whereas in Persuance of all dated the 27 th day of April in the year 1772 granted by the late proprieters of Pennsylvania unto Patrick Redman for the Surveying unto him a certain tract of land Situate on Limestone run in the Forks of the River two or three Miles from where the said run empties itself into the West Branch, late in Berks County now in the County of Northumberland Afs. These were South sixty five degrees west fifty perches to a black oak., thence by Vacant Land north twenty five degrees west seventy nine perches to a rock, thence by Vacant Land South Sixty five Degrees west one hundred & seventy three perches to the first mentioned Black Oak & place of beginning Containing two hundred & Seventeen & one half acres of land and an area of Six for Gt gof roads & highways etc_ And Whereas the said Patrick Redman by his Certain Indenture being dated the 24th day of July 1771 Did grant bargain and sell the lands & tenements afs. Unto Robert Magaw Esq. Inspect And Whereas the said Robert Magaw by his Certain Indenture bearing Date the 8th day of October 1774 did grant bargain and sell (among other things) the afs. Land Tenements & promises with the Appurtenances unto the said Robert Moodie in principle as by the said Indenture recorded in the recorders office at Sunbury in and for the County of Northumberland in book G page 136. & or at large Appears: And Whereas the said Robert Moodie afterwards died having first made his last will and testament in Writing Bearing Date the 11th day of August in the year \or our Lord 1778 And thereby did appoint assign Wm. McClay & William Plunket Exec's of the said will; and whereas the said Robert Moodie by the said will did Desire that all his lands or real estate whatsoever as the Exigency of his family should require, be sold by his executors and thereby did Empower his said executors or any two of them to sell convey & make over to any purchasers parts such parts & parcels of his said Estate and lands be deemed requisite : And Whereas afterward the said last will & testament of said Robert Moodie was duly proved before the Register of the County of Northumberland afs. And where in his Office in Book A. Page 36 And Whereas the Executors afs. Refused to take on themselves the Burden of the Executors of the said Will & Absolutely renounced their Interest therein Whereafter Administration of all singular the goods & Chattles rights & Credits of the said Robert Moodie Deceased with a copy of the will afs. Their desire was granted in due & Common form of law unto Robert Robb, John Macpherson, & David Ireland afs. By the recorder remaining in the Office of the Recorder at Sunbury appears at large: And Whereas Divers Expenses Arrangements in the family of the said Robert Moodie have happened & cometopass. Whereby it became absolutely necessary to sell & Dispose of a parcel of the real Estate of the said Robert Moodie Deceased. Now this Indenture Witnesseth that the said Robert Robb, John Macpherson, for & in consideration of the sum of one hundred & sixteen pounds and five shillings in gold & silver current money of Pennsylvania to us in hand paid by David Ireland the weight and payment whereof we do hereby Acknowledge. Do grant bargain sell alien confess release & Confirm that by these present do grant bargain sell alien confess release & Confirm unto the said David Ireland his hiers and assigns the following piece or parcel of land being part of the land of the afs. Described Tract Beginning at a rock by David Ireland's land south twenty seven degrees east one hundred & sixty five perches to a Black Oak, thence by Limestone Ridge north Sixty three Degrees east eighty seven perches to a post, thence by ?? Land north Eleven Degrees west one hundred & thirty five perches to a post, thence south seventy seven degrees west one hundred perches to the first mentioned rock & point of Beginning Containing ninety three acres with allowance of six acres for roads & highways with all & singular the ways woods waters water courses rights liberties privileges Acreditaments Apperturances whatsoever there unto belonging or in any way wise appertaining to the revenues and remainders rents issues & profits thereof To have and to hold the last Described Tract of land & tenements hereby grant or meant mentioned or intended so to be with the Apperturances unto the said David Ireland his heirs and assigns So the only proper use benefit & behalf of him the said David Ireland his heirs and assigns forever: In Witness whereof the Justice afs. To these presents have Interchangeably set their hands & seals the day & year first above within: Robt. Robb [seal] John Macpherson [seal] Sealed & Delivered in the presence of us Alexander McDonald, James Duncan; Received the 7 day of November Anno D. 1792 from David Ireland the sum of one hundred & Sixteen pounds 5/ lawful money of the State of Pennsylvania it being the consideration money in full with mentioned: Received for mr. Robt. Robb, John Macpherson test. of Sum Sworn: James Duncan, Northumberland County Ws. Be it known that in the 29th day of January in the year of our Lord 1793. Before me John Simpson Esq. One of the Justices of the peace in and for the County afs & Personally Comith Robt. Robb and John Macpherson the grantors above mentioned Who in due form of law did Acknowledge the above written Indenture to be their act & Deed to the intent it may as such be entered on Record According to law as Witness my hand &Seal the day & year Afs. J. Simpson [seal] Recorded the 18 th of February AD 1798. [initialed by the recorder]
